If you notice banner ads appearing on websites that weren’t there before, it’s possible that you have accidentally installed adware on your computer. It might have been installed, for instance, together with a new browser. You can delete adware using the PC Cleaner tool:
During the installation of an application, you might not notice a series of checkboxes besides additional applications that are installed by default. Should this be the case, you might accidentally install adware. To prevent adware being installed on your computer, configure Application Manager.

When you browse websites, their owners collect information about your activity in order to offer you targeted ads based on your preferences. To prevent websites from collecting your data, configure Private Browsing.

Adware detection is enabled by default in Kaspersky products. However, you should also enable the detection of legal applications that can be used for advertising purposes.
Configure Web Anti-Virus so that your Kaspersky application checks websites for advertising.
The application will alert you if you attempt to open an advertising website.
